Conduct evaluations of patients in both inpatient and outpatient settings and craft customized treatment plans Deliver physical therapy interventions concentrating on mobility, strength, balance, and functional capabilities Collaborate with nurses, physicians, case managers, and other rehabilitation professionals to maximize patient outcomes Instruct patients and families about therapeutic objectives, discharge planning, and at-home exercise regimens Document patient evaluations, treatments, and advancements in compliance with institutional and regulatory standards Participate in multidisciplinary rounds and interdisciplinary meetings to ensure seamless care Education
Doctor of Physical Therapy (DPT) or an equivalent degree from an accredited program Certifications
State licensure as a Physical Therapist CPR certification preferred Specialty certifications (e.g., neurological, geriatric) are advantageous but not mandatory Skills
Prior experience is strongly preferred Capable of treating patients with intricate medical and mobility challenges Excellent communication and teamwork abilities Familiarity with digital charting and clinical documentation platforms Benefits
